Lourdes began designing beautiful clothing after her graduation from The Fashion Institute of Design and Merchandising specializing in couture design. Lourdes was born and meant to be a designer but is equally a talented pattern maker and sewer which serves to enhance her entire process. Her career began with two prestigious houses in Los Angeles but her true talent and creativity blossomed when she opened her own house in December of 1997. Lourdes has been creating amazing designs with each collection and developing into a world class designer who has been honored and received numerous awards by the State of California, City of Hope, Fashion Institute of Design and Merchandising, and the Fashion Group International to name a few. Today, Lourdes Chavez is a multi-million dollar company with accounts at the finest specialty stores and boutiques in the nation.
Established in 1994, Christine A. Moore MIllinery is based in New York City on 34th Street between the Fashion and Accessories districts. Although Christine designs a wide range of women’s and men’s collections, she is best known for her explosive racing styles for the Kentucky Derby, two of which are in the Kentrucky Derby Museum. In 2009, she partnered with Churchill Downs and Mattel to design the official Barbie Derby hat. Her hats were used in the 2009 official Kentucky Derby poster. She has designed both the Oaks and Derby hats for Kentucky’s former first lady Jane Beshear, and Preakness hats for the past two mayors of Baltimore. Christine has been on the “Today Show” live from Churchill Downs six times, where NBC calls her the “milliner to the triple crown.” Her hats have graced many magazine covers including InStyle with Katy Perry and Vanity Fair with Jennifer Lopez, to name a few. Her hats have been on many television shows including, “Nashville,” “Gossip Girl,” “The Carrie Diaries” and “Horseplayers.”
